Pull to refresh
38
-0.3
Владимир @Civil

человек(?).

Send message

Релейный компьютер, телетайп и интересный алгоритм игры в крестики-нолики

Reading time10 min
Views6.6K

Крестики-нолики – классическая игра, которую наверное пытался написать каждый. При этом программы иногда получаются довольно запутанные, несмотря на простоту правил. Электромагнитные реле – классическая элементная база для компьютеров и калькуляторов. Они тёплые, ламповые и прикольно щёлкают. Если добавить к этому телетайп, то получится игровая консоль в стиле 1940х.

Читать далее
Total votes 68: ↑68 and ↓0+68
Comments35

«Папа» Эльбруса. Ноутбук на VLIW процессоре TransMeta Crusoe TM5800 с динамической ретрансляцией из 2003 года

Reading time14 min
Views13K
В некоторых своих статьях, при малейшем упоминании Эльбруса и МЦСТ в положительном ключе, некоторые мои читатели пытались поднять тему а-ля «Эльбрус это перемаркированый чип из Тайваня», не особо вникая в то, как это работает под капотом и почему Эльбрус — это действительно круто. Но кое в чём эти люди правы, ведь концептуально, Эльбрус действительно не первый в своём роде, есть у него и «папа», который работал по схожему принципу динамической ретрансляции из x86 и вышел на 5 лет ранее. Недавно я купил ноутбук iRu на TransMeta Crusoe 5800 всего за 1.000 рублей, который под капотом использует VLIW архитектуру с динамической ретрансляцией кода из x86 в свой машинный код. Интересно узнать, насколько далеко Эльбрус ушёл от своего приёмного «отца» за 20 лет существования? Тогда добро пожаловать под кат!

image
Читать дальше →
Total votes 65: ↑62 and ↓3+59
Comments114

Как я собрал себе домашний «Эльбрус» и как было надо

Reading time6 min
Views18K
Всем привет и на этот раз с наступившим :-)

Это вторая статья — та, которую начал было новогодним вечером по ещё осенней задумке, но к которой как раз и понадобилась первая в качестве вводной. Возможно, получится отдельно описать и темы, намёки на которые были предложены в опросе.

В любом случае нижеизложенное в большей степени является самоиронией, чем суровым техническим обзором — хотя желающие, как обычно, найдут в нём что угодно.



Краткий вариант моих «Приключений Робинзона Крузо»: в мае 2022 года принял решение и приступил к закупкам (материнская плата и кулер); за июнь-июль закрыл вопрос с памятью и параллельно доводил дистрибутив; к августу машинка в нулевом приближении заработала (но удавалось поймать нестабильную работу DDR4 именно на 3200) — а в сентябре после отпуска сложились завершающие кусочки: бутовщики довели прошивку в части таймингов и приехала SSD от GS Nanotech; оставалось свести всё воедино, поставить систему и перетащить ключики, что и было сделано.

Краткий вывод: занимайся своим делом, уделяя ему должное внимание; умел пять лет назад — может, умеешь и сейчас, но внимание понадобится вдвойне.

Ну а более полное изложение — на основании сентябрьских записок по свежим следам.
Читать дальше →
Total votes 94: ↑73 and ↓21+52
Comments213

Новая эра российской микроэлектроники: представлен процессор Baikal-S

Reading time3 min
Views67K

На прошедшей неделе достаточно незаметно для прессы произошло эпохальное событие в истории российской микроэлектроники – 15 декабря на ежегодной конференции компании Байкал Электроникс был представлен процессор серверного класса Baikal-S. Пока широкая общественность бурно обсуждала отчёт о тестировании Сбербанком серверов на базе Эльбрус-8С, смакуя различные детали этой горячей истории, люди, чуть более погруженные в индустрию, с нетерпением ждали анонса Baikal-S.

Почему так? Чем же так эпохален этот процессор?

Может быть, он безоговорочно рвёт на тестах конкурентов из Intel/AMD, заставляя менеджеров данных компаний лихорадочно учить кириллицу? Нет, это вполне себе «средненький» серверный процессор уровне Intel Xeon Gold 6148 или того же злополучного Intel Xeon Gold 6230.

Возможно, у него есть какие-то невообразимые новинки в функционале, до которых не смог  додуматься никто в мире? Опять-таки нет, функционал процессора абсолютно стандартен и соответствует аналогичным решениям на базе архитектуры ArmV8.

В чём же тогда уникальность данного процессора, в чём прорыв, спросит читатель? Ответ очень прост – именно в том, что это первый в новейшей истории России конкурентноспособный general-purpose high performance CPU. Причём конкурентноспособный во всех смыслах – по цене, по производительности, по потребляемой мощности. Никаких уникальностей и «аналоговнет». Просто хороший чип, способный достойно соревноваться с конкурентами, с понятными рыночной нишей и перспективами. На конференции Baikal-S был назван (абсолютно верно на мой взгляд) «рабочей лошадкой». Это та самая «рабочая лошадка», которая в состоянии заменить сотни тысяч и миллионы процессоров уровня Xeon, работающих сейчас в датацентрах и на предприятиях всей России(и не только). И сделать это так, чтобы слово «импортозамещение» вызывало у людей не ухмылку и чувство неполноценности, а гордость за страну.

Читать далее
Total votes 182: ↑171 and ↓11+160
Comments357

Information

Rating
Does not participate
Location
Adliswil, Zürich, Швейцария
Date of birth
Registered
Activity